1971 Chrysler Valiant vs. 2007 GMC Yukon

To start off, 2007 GMC Yukon is newer by 36 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1971 Chrysler Valiant.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1971 Chrysler Valiant would be higher. At 4,802 cc (8 cylinders), 2007 GMC Yukon is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 GMC Yukon (295 HP @ 500 RPM) has 132 more horse power than 1971 Chrysler Valiant. (163 HP @ 4400 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2007 GMC Yukon should accelerate faster than 1971 Chrysler Valiant.

Because 2007 GMC Yukon is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1971 Chrysler Valiant.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 GMC Yukon will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 GMC Yukon (414 Nm @ 4800 RPM) has 96 more torque (in Nm) than 1971 Chrysler Valiant. (318 Nm @ 1800 RPM). This means 2007 GMC Yukon will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1971 Chrysler Valiant.

Compare all specifications:

1971 Chrysler Valiant 2007 GMC Yukon
Make Chrysler GMC
Model Valiant Yukon
Year Released 1971 2007
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 4015 cc 4802 cc
Engine Cylinders 6 cylinders 8 cylinders
Engine Type in-line V
Horse Power 163 HP 295 HP
Engine RPM 4400 RPM 500 RPM
Torque 318 Nm 414 Nm
Torque RPM 1800 RPM 4800 RPM
Drive Type Rear 4WD
Vehicle Length 4900 mm 5660 mm
Vehicle Width 1890 mm 2020 mm
Vehicle Height 1440 mm 1960 mm
Wheelbase Size 2830 mm 3310 mm
